What affects the price

The final price for your gas fireplace installation depends on several moving parts. It starts with the unit itself—whether you choose a basic insert or a high-end designer model with custom stone work. We also look at your existing venting setup; if we need to run new lines or modify your chimney, labor costs will increase. Gas line access and electrical requirements are other variables that shift the total investment. We can provide ex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

About this service

Gas fireplace repair is necessary when your unit fails to ignite, shuts off unexpectedly, or produces excess soot. A technician will inspect the pilot assembly, thermocouple, gas valve, and ventilation system to pinpoint why the fireplace is malfunctioning. Since these systems involve gas and combustion, it is important to have a pro handle repairs to keep your home safe and warm. We identify the broken component and perform the necessary fix to get your hearth running smoothly again.
